The five ‘S’ methodology, which is a system for organizing spaces so work can be performed efficiently, includes Sort, Set in order, Shine, Standardize, and Sustain. Each of these components is essential to creating an organized and high-functioning work environment. The principle of 'Simplify' is not part of the five ‘S’ framework. Instead, 'Sort' refers to the process of distinguishing between necessary and unnecessary items, allowing a workspace to be decluttered. The focus of 'Set in order' is on arranging tools and materials in a way that enhances workflow. 'Shine' emphasizes cleanliness and maintaining a tidy work area. 'Standardize' involves creating consistent practices for maintaining the first three S's, and 'Sustain' encourages maintaining discipline to ensure that the organization becomes habitual. Therefore, 'Simplify' does not fit with the established principles of the five ‘S’ methodology, which emphasizes structuring and organizing workspace rather than simply simplifying processes.
